编程中最基本的存储单位是什么
-
编程中最基本的存储单位是位(bit)。
在计算机中,所有的数据都是以二进制形式存储和处理的。而位(bit)是二进制的最小单位,它只能表示0或1两个状态。位(bit)是计算机存储和处理信息的基本单元,它可以表示一个开关的状态,或者是一个逻辑值。
位(bit)是由电子元件(如晶体管)的导通和不导通来表示的。导通表示1,不导通表示0。多个位(bit)可以组合成更大的存储单位,如字节(byte)、千字节(kilobyte)、兆字节(megabyte)等。
字节(byte)是计算机中常用的存储单位,它由8个位(bit)组成,可以表示256种不同的状态。字节(byte)是计算机中最基本的存储单位,所有的数据都是以字节(byte)的形式在计算机内存中存储的。
除了位(bit)和字节(byte),还有其他的存储单位,如千字节(kilobyte)、兆字节(megabyte)、吉字节(gigabyte)等。它们分别是字节(byte)的一千倍、一百万倍、一亿倍等。这些存储单位常用于描述计算机的存储容量和文件大小。
在编程中,我们可以使用位(bit)来进行数据的操作和处理。比如,可以使用位(bit)来表示一个开关的状态,或者是一个布尔值的真假。位(bit)还可以用来进行位运算,如与、或、非、异或等。位(bit)的灵活运用可以帮助我们更好地处理和操作数据。
总结来说,编程中最基本的存储单位是位(bit),它是二进制的最小单位,用于表示开关状态或逻辑值。位(bit)可以组合成更大的存储单位,如字节(byte)、千字节(kilobyte)、兆字节(megabyte)等。在编程中,我们可以使用位(bit)进行数据的操作和处理。
1年前 -
编程中最基本的存储单位是位(bit)和字节(byte)。
-
位(bit)是计算机中最小的存储单位,它只能表示0或1两种状态。计算机中所有的数据都是以位的形式存储和处理的。位可以用于表示布尔值、开关状态、逻辑值等。
-
字节(byte)是计算机中常用的存储单位,由8个位组成。一个字节可以表示0~255之间的整数。字节是计算机中最基本的存储单元,用于存储字符、整数、浮点数等各种数据类型。
-
位和字节的关系是1字节等于8位。字节在计算机中是按照连续的地址进行存储的,因此可以通过字节来访问和操作存储在计算机中的数据。
-
计算机中的主存储器(RAM)以字节为单位进行寻址和存储。主存储器是计算机用于存储程序和数据的地方,它以字节的形式组织和管理存储空间。
-
在编程中,常常需要使用位运算来对位进行操作和处理。位运算可以用于进行位的与、或、非、异或等操作,以及位的移位、旋转等操作,常用于图像处理、密码学等领域。
总结起来,位和字节是编程中最基本的存储单位,用于表示和处理计算机中的数据。位和字节的概念和操作在计算机科学和编程中都具有重要的意义。
1年前 -
-
编程中最基本的存储单位是位(bit)。一个位可以表示二进制的0或1,是计算机中最小的存储单位。计算机中的所有数据都是以位的形式存储和处理的。
在计算机中,数据以二进制的形式表示。二进制是一种计数系统,只包含0和1两个数字。每个位都可以表示一个二进制数字,而多个位组合在一起可以表示更大的数字或其他类型的数据。
位(bit)是计算机中最小的存储单位,它可以表示两个状态:0和1。计算机内部的处理和存储都是以位为基础的。8个位组成一个字节(byte),一个字节可以表示256种不同的状态。
除了位和字节,计算机还有其他更大的存储单位,如千字节(KB)、兆字节(MB)、吉字节(GB)等。这些单位是用来表示存储容量的,每个单位都是前一个单位的1024倍。
在编程中,我们通常使用不同的数据类型来表示不同的数据。例如,整数(int)数据类型可以表示整数值,浮点数(float)数据类型可以表示小数值,字符(char)数据类型可以表示单个字符等。不同的数据类型在内存中占用的位数也不同,这取决于计算机的体系结构和编程语言的规范。
在编程中,我们可以通过位操作来处理位级数据。位操作包括位与(and)、位或(or)、位异或(xor)、位左移(shift left)、位右移(shift right)等操作。这些操作可以用来对位级数据进行逻辑运算、移位操作等。
总之,位(bit)是编程中最基本的存储单位,它是计算机内部处理和存储数据的基础。了解位的概念和位操作对于理解计算机底层原理和进行编程开发都非常重要。
1年前